This may not be the norm, but I had a terrible experience with this particular store. Went in to buy a piece of cut plexiglass (20"x20"). They took out a giant piece of plexiglass and cut my piece from it. I asked if they planned on charging me for the original piece or just the 20"x20" section, and they said my section would be $16.99. Sounds good. When I got to the register and I was being rung up for $16.99, the owner came by and said thats not correct and that I need to buy the original piece (~$35)! The problem seemed to result from a serious disconnect between the owner and the employees, which ultimately falls on poor management skills by the owner. Just out of curiosity, I stopped by another Ace on my way home and they said they would have cut my piece for ~$12. I even called their other store in Decatur (same owner) and they said that a 20"x20" plexiglass would cost me $14.99. When I called the store that I bought it from and talked to the owner he spoke with a condescending tone and actually hung up on me. Aaarrrrggg ... worst managerial/business sense ever. Anyone need a picture framed? I almost have enough extra plexiglass to frame TWO more 20"x20" pictures...
